BG05 VDR is a 2005 Mazda 3 in Grey with a 1,560cc petrol engine. This vehicle has been through 22 MOT tests with a personal pass rate of 72.7%.
Across all 2005 Mazda 3 models, the average MOT pass rate is 74.0% with a typical mileage of 71,203 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Mazda 3 f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 40,716 recorded failures. If you're considering buying BG05 VDR, it's worth having these areas checked by a mechanic before committing.
The Mazda 3 typically stays on UK roads for around 22 years. At 21 years old, this Mazda 3 is approaching the upper end of the typical lifespan for this model.
